Plessey has a long history of innovation. Founded in 1956, we have evolved from one of Europe’s earliest semiconductor pioneers into the world’s most advanced Micro

LED specialist. Over the decades, Plessey has built a first class, fully integrated platform designing, manufacturing, and engineering next‑generation display technologies entirely in house. This end to end capability, combined with our strong IP portfolio, uniquely positions us to lead the scaling of Micro

LEDs from lab innovation to high-volume production.

Our future is even brighter. We believe Micro

LEDs will define the next era of technology—powering ultra‑efficient AR/VR displays, driving optical processors that make AI faster and more sustainable, and enabling devices yet to be imagined. With our unique expertise and talented team, we are positioned to lead this transformation.

About the Role

We are looking for a Senior Equipment Engineer to provide support across the Films & MOCVD technology teams. You will provide technical leadership, tool ownership, and continuous improvement within our semiconductor manufacturing operation. This role is responsible for maximising equipment uptime, yield, reliability, and process stability, while also driving innovation in tool performance, automation, and preventative maintenance.

Key Responsibilities
  • Own assigned tools end-to-end, including uptime, availability and process stability.
  • Proactively monitor equipment performance against defined targets, proactively addressing issues to minimise downtime and maximise efficiency.
  • Collaborate cross‑functionally with process, maintenance, production, facilities, and quality teams, as well as external tool vendors and R&D partners, to ensure equipment reliability, optimise performance, and support technology advancement.
  • Maintain accurate documentation and ensure spare parts availability to support optimal tool performance.
  • Drive continuous improvement initiatives to keep tools operating at peak condition.
  • Keep up to date on the latest upgrades and enhancements that improve process quality and equipment reliability,
  • Benchmark tool performance against industry standards and partner with vendors to achieve and sustain top‑tier results.
  • Anticipate and manage part obsolescence risks by developing robust contingency plans
  • Support the successful installation, qualification, and integration of new tools into fab operations.
